Job Description

Whitehall Resources are currently looking for a Salesforce Technical Architect based in Warwickshire for an initial 6 month contract.

Job Responsibility

  • Design, develop, and deliver high-performing, secure, and scalable technical solutions on the Salesforce platform
  • Act as the bridge between business requirements and technical implementation, leading teams, enforcing development best practices, and specializing in integrations (APIs), Apex, Lightning components, and data modelling
